This game is great for building speed with identifying sight words. This game works well as a small group or whole group activity. To set up the game, you’ll need to write a few sight words on the board. Select one student to play. Call out a sight word and have them quickly swat the ...

WebStudents build the word, then write the word. I also make sight word bags for students to work on in guided reading. I place 5-6 word cards and magnetic letters needed to build the word into a pencil bag. In the beginning of the year, I differentiate the bags based on group. As the year progresses, I make individual student bags. WebSight word literacy centers are a must in kindergarten! Whether you use Pre Primer Dolch sight words, Primer Dolch sight words, Fry words, or another list, the ultimate goal is to read the words by sight. When learning new high-frequency words, it can take 17 exposures to make the word a sight word. These exposures can occur through whole group ...

The other 5 pages will have CVC words for students to write ... incoterm prepaid and chargeWebHere’s how it works: Print out your list of weekly spelling words on slips of paper, and place each slip into a bowl. Line students up in two teams at the hoop. The student at the front of line 1 will select a paper slip from the bowl and read the word out loud. The student at the front of the other line then has to spell that word out loud. incoterm port duWebMar 21, 2015 · Reading Sight Words Fluently in Isolation: We start by touching and reading each sight word in isolation.
